Panic Buttons for the senior are offered in lots of options and with many features. Generally a panic button is an emergency button which can be pressed in case of an emergency, whether it be a fall, or cardiac arrest. These panic buttons can be used around the neck or as a bracelet.
Panic buttons can be one way or 2-way. A one way panic button for the elderly will operate in one method just. The person in distress presses a button, which sends out a signal. Typically this will position an emergency call to the numbers already set into the system.
When an individual takes the call, he is asked to enter in a number. If the number is entered properly, then the system assumes that it is a live individual and not an answering device. The system will play the message for the individual raising the call.
In a 2-way system, a 2-way interaction is developed in between the individual in distress and the emergency alert provider. This is why it is crucial you select a trusted provider. It is well worth the few additional dollars spent each month, in return for quality service and reaction.
Some 2-way provider will supply extra service. Some alarm business will pull up medical records of the patient to figure out if he has any known medical issues. This makes sure instant service and can prevent a great deal of inconvenience and frustration.
Panic buttons for the senior can be used as a bracelet, pendant or on the belt. They are generally water proof so there is no problems with the emergency alert systems getting ruined due to moisture.

Senior Alert Systems and Medical Alert Devices FAQ
-
- Do You want a Home-Based or Mobile System?
Originally, medical alert systems were created to work inside your house, with your landline telephone.
And you can still go that route. Lots of companies likewise now provide the choice of home-based systems that work over a cellular network, for those who may not have a landline.
With these systems, pressing the wearable call button allows you to speak with a dispatcher through a base unit situated in your house.
But numerous business offer mobile choices, too. You can use these systems at home, but they’ll also allow you to call for help while you’re out and about.
These run over cellular networks and incorporate GPS innovation. This way, if you get lost or push the call button for assistance however are unable to talk, the tracking service can locate you.
-
- Should You Add a Fall-Detection Feature?
Some companies offer the option of automatic fall detection, for an additional monthly fee. Manufacturers say these devices sense falls when they occur and automatically contact the dispatch center, just as they would if you had pressed the call button.
-
- Whats the Cost?
Fees. Beware of complicated pricing plans and hidden fees. Look for a company with no extra fees related to equipment, shipping, installation, activation, or service and repair. Don’t fall for scams that offer free service or “donated or used” equipment.
Contracts. You should not have to enter into a long-term contract. You should only have to pay ongoing monthly fees, which should range between $25 and $45 a month (about $1 a day). Be careful about paying for service in advance, since you never know when you’ll need to stop the service temporarily (due to a hospitalization, for instance) or permanently.
Guarantee and cancellation policies. Look for a full money-back guarantee, or at least a trial period, in case you are not satisfied with the service. And you’ll want the ability to cancel at any time with no penalties (and a full refund if monthly fees have already been paid).
Discounts. Ask about discounts for multiple people in the same household, as well as for veterans, membership organizations, medical insurance or via a hospital, medical or care organization. Ask if the company offers any discount options or a sliding fee scale for people with lower incomes.
Insurance. For the most part, Medicare and private insurance companies will not cover the costs of a medical alert. In some states Medicaid may cover all or part of the cost. You can check with your private insurance company to see if it offers discounts or referrals.
Tax deductions. Check with your tax professional to find out if the cost of a medical alert is tax deductible as a medically necessary expense.

Brocton is a village in Chautauqua County, New York, United States. The name was derived by combining the names "Brockway" and "Minton", two prominent local families. The population was 1,486 at the 2010 census.[2] Brocton is within the town of Portland.
The Lakeview Shock Incarceration Correctional Facility, a state prison, is located just north of the village limits.
The community was first settled in 1805 by Captain James Dunn. The village of Brocton was incorporated in 1894. Brocton used to be named "Salems Corners (Cross Roads)" after Salem, Massachusetts, but was later renamed "Brocton".
